Delhi: Anti-Auto Theft Squad nab 2 in Dwarka for possession of illegal firearms, links to Saddam Gouri gang uncovered
The Anti- Auto Theft Squad (AATS) Dwarka District team has arrested two individuals, Ravi @ Budhi @ Jalebi and Nishant, in connection with possession of illegal firearms. The accused were found in possession of two country-made pistols and two live cartridges.

Delhi Police clarifies Jamia Millia Islamia Polytechnic incident
According to the police, an employee of JMI Polytechnic had lodged a complaint against an Associate Professor of the Civil Engineering Department, alleging physical assault, manhandling, and the use of caste-based slurs and abuses. The complaint also stated that a physical scuffle occurred on campus.

Women in live-in relationships should be granted status of "wife"
The Madurai Bench of the Madras High Court has ruled that women in live-in relationships should be granted the status of "wife" to ensure their protection, citing the ancient concept of Gandharva marriage.
Delhi records 'very poor' air quality as AQI stands at 341
Delhi continued to reel under 'very poor' air quality on Wednesday morning, with the Air Quality Index (AQI) recorded at 341 around 7 am, according to data released by the Central Pollution Control Board (CPCB).
